In College Factual's most recent rankings for the best schools for ecosystem studies majors, Texas A&M College Station came in at #5. This puts it in the top 5% of the country in this field of study. It is also ranked #1 in Texas.
During the 2020-2021 academic year, Texas A&M University - College Station handed out 74 bachelor's degrees in environmental studies. This is an increase of 4% over the previous year when 71 degrees were handed out.

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the ecosystem studies majors at Texas A&M University - College Station.
During the 2020-2021 academic year, 74 students graduated with a bachelor's degree in ecosystem studies from Texas A&M College Station. About 36% were men and 64% were women.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Texas A&M University - College Station with a bachelor's in ecosystem studies.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 4 |
Black or African American | 1 |
Hispanic or Latino | 23 |
White | 37 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 2 |
Other Races | 7 |
